Patch Paw Pals: Jack

Animal House Shelter's boxer-pit bull mix Jack is the pet of the week. He is waiting to be adopted after his previous owners took him back due to a divorce.

With a brindle coat, Huntley Animal House Shelter’s 5-year-old Jack found himself right back where he started. The boxer-pit bull mix originally came from a high-kill facility where he was nearly put down with his littermates.

Huntley’s shelter came to the rescue, and within a year a married couple adopted him. Four years later, to his dismay, he’s back again, after the couple went through a divorce.

“Now he is back for Round Two” at the shelter, said manager Marcus Bunda.

According to Bunda, Jack was a bit shy when he returned to Animal House just a few weeks ago. Since then, though, he has opened up and is coming out of his shell.

Jack is a house-trained, loving, 50-pound boy with potential to get along with other dogs. First and foremost, however, he just wants an owner to take him in.
